George Cary spent five years as a McKinsey EM. In this live case, he coaches candidate Harvey through a real McKinsey market entry study: should a diesel truck manufacturer build and sell electric trucks.

Harvey builds a framework, runs the full cost-of-ownership math, and lands a final recommendation. George pauses after every section to break down good vs. great in real time.

You'll learn:

  • Why McKinsey calls it "problem solving," not casing – and the vocabulary that signals you already think like a consultant
  • How Harvey turns a good, structured framework into a great, distinctive one 
  • The full math behind pricing an e-truck – and how to talk through your logic instead of just stating the number
